An alloy which does not contain copper is:

  1. solder

  2. bronze

  3. brass

  4. bell metal

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ation

Solder- an alloy of tin $(Sn)$ and lead $(Pb)$
Bronze-an alloy of copper $(Cu)$ and tin $(Sn)$
Brass-an alloy of copper $(Cu)$ and Zinc $(Zn)$
Bell metal-an alloy of copper $(Cu)$ and tin $(Sn)$
Therefore option A is correct

Which of the following alloy contains mercury?

  1. Bronze

  2. Zinc amalgam

  3. Brass

  4. German silver

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

Amalgam is a substance formed by the reaction of mercury with another metal.Almost all metals form amalgams with mercury with exceptions being iron,platinum,tungsten and tantalum.Silver-mercury amalgams are important in dentistry.

Identify the alloy which does not contain zinc metal.

  1. Gun metal

  2. German silver

  3. Brass

  4. Bronze

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

Bronze is an alloy of $Cu$ and $Sn$. It does not contain zinc metal.

Alloy                                 Metals present
Gun metal $Cu$ (88%) $Sn$ (10%) $Zn$ (2%)
German silver $Cu,\ Zn$ and $Ni$
Brass $Cu$ and $Zn$
Bronze $Cu$ and $Sn$
